Analysis
Eastern Africa recorded 1.56 million 1000 USD for meat of goat, fresh or chilled (indigenous) — gross production value in 2024.
The figure is down 0.4% on the previous year and up 60.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, meat of goat, fresh or chilled (indigenous) — gross production value in Eastern Africa peaked at 1.56 million 1000 USD in 2023 and was at its lowest, 139,205 1000 USD, in 1993.
That places Eastern Africa 9th out of 27 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
